What the hell is going on people??

First Don Youngblood passes away just 2 weeks ago. Now I hear word that Anthony Clark (Power Lifter) has died at the age of 39. In the last few years Tom Prince, Flex Wheeler, Kevin Levrone, Milos Sarcev, Don Long, and a few other have all been forced to retire because of life threating illness. Flex and Don had to have kidney replacments, and others are on various different meds for the rest of there life.

All of these guys that I grew up looking up too are all being forced to leave the sport. The sport of bodybuilding that we love so much is slowly killing us. I believe this is due to changes in the sport that started in the late 80's threw the 90's and is now worse then ever in 2005. Its my oppinion bodybuilding hit an all time high in the period from around 1995-1999. Meaning the mix of mass and shape was perfect in my eyes. Take a look at some of the shows from the late 90's and the guys looked great. Fast forward to 2005 and take a look at the NY Pro that just happened last week. I felt like taking a shit when I looked at some of the guys on stage. Nothing but lumps and under developed muscle. No symetry at all and no future.

Chemicals like, Insulin, IGF-1, Diuretics, 17aa's, huge amounts of HGH and several other drugs are killing the sport.

What the fuck happened to a simple Test cycle and maybe and oral to kick off the cycle. I take one look around the boards including this one and I see people that look like nothing taking all these various drugs and have nothing to show for it. What these people dont understand is that there slowly killing themselves.

Lets get back to bodybuilding and good old fashion muscle and lets stop this very ugly trend that has started to take over the world of bodybuilding.
